Kat Stratford (Julia Stiles): From Riot Grrrl to Director's Chair
Julia Stiles' portrayal of Kat Stratford is often cited as a feminist touchstone in teen cinema, a character who refused to conform to societal expectations.
Recent Career Updates (2024-2025): Stiles has successfully transitioned into a dynamic career both in front of and behind the camera. Her most significant recent achievement is her directorial debut feature film, Wish You Were Here, which premiered in January 2024. She has also maintained a steady acting career, appearing in the 2022 horror prequel Orphan: First Kill and the 2024 film Chosen Family. Stiles continues to reflect on the enduring legacy of 10 Things I Hate About You, noting that it is the role she is still most recognized for.

Cameron James (Joseph Gordon-Levitt): From Teen Heartthrob to Sci-Fi Auteur
Joseph Gordon-Levitt, who played the lovestruck Cameron James, has arguably one of the most diverse and successful careers of the entire cast.
Recent Career Updates (2024-2025): Gordon-Levitt has a packed schedule of current and upcoming projects. In 2024, he starred in the films Killer Heat and Greedy People alongside Lily James. Furthermore, he is returning to the director's chair for the first time in over a decade with an untitled AI thriller project, and is set to lead the Darren Aronofsky-produced horror film Pendulum, showcasing his commitment to complex, genre-bending material.

Mr. Morgan (Daryl Mitchell): The Woke English Teacher
Daryl Mitchell’s Mr. Morgan was the English teacher who challenged his students with feminist literature and served as a comedic sounding board for Kat’s intellectual frustrations.
Recent Career Updates (2025): Mitchell is set to return to television in a major capacity. He has been cast in the upcoming 2025 TV comedy series Shifting Gears, which will see him reunite with his Galaxy Quest co-star, Tim Allen. This marks a significant new project for the actor, who has also starred in popular shows like NCIS: New Orleans.
Ms. Perky (Allison Janney): The Erotic Novelist Guidance Counselor
Allison Janney’s Ms. Perky, the guidance counselor secretly writing erotic fiction, was a hilariously subversive character who represented the hidden lives of adults.
Recent Career Updates (2024): Janney, an Oscar winner, remains one of the busiest and most acclaimed actors in Hollywood. In 2024, she had a guest role in the Netflix political drama series The Diplomat and starred in the Apple TV+ comedy series Palm Royale. She was also announced to star in an upcoming feature film directed by Jim Rash, further cementing her status as a prolific actress.
